UPDATE

After weeks of no contact through countless emails and phone calls. I decided to check their facebook page. To present, it has been updated 19 times since my complaint/contact started. So you can take my money and not return a call or email, but status updates are a priority? That ticked me off a bit.

HUGE THANK YOU to xj5x, because I did exactly what you did, I called TAG. Tactical Assault Gear and I long history. Fresh out of School of Infantry I rolled into "The Operator's Choice" in Jacksonville, NC and replaced most of my issued M4/M16 mag pouches with TAG pouches. That was in 2004. The only pouches that survived my enlistment were TAG pouches and a pair of double/doubles are still with me today. When xj5x told me that TAG was producing the RG gear, I was at least somewhat relieved because at least I knew it would be good gear that was well made. So I called.

I spoke with a lovely lady named Jennifer and asked if TAG was associated with Rogue Gunfighter. Her reply, "Not anymore." I asked when they had ended their connection and she said "Let me guess. You ordered some gear, they took your money, and you haven't heard from them or seen your product?" After a brief conversation  I placed an order with TAG which she gracefully facilitated and I should have my kit next week. I then called my credit card company and started working to get my money back from RG, as they were incommunicado.

I will never do business with RG again, and warn off anyone who asks. It's a shame that this whole ordeal could have been instantly averted with one returned phone cal or email. I will however instantly go back to TAG.
